Output 3178c7e4c58a405d0b24b6f21ab5e2fe768c9c655c248151c2d9a155c232a5a8:3

value
70261102
script pubkey
OP_0 OP_PUSHBYTES_32 eff8290b9c2670df54acc50f0c1337b7cb8b06e51f992104fe1a1554efbc6a67
address
bc1qaluzjzuuyecd749vc58scyehkl9ckph9r7vjzp87rg24fmaudfnsltdy69
transaction
3178c7e4c58a405d0b24b6f21ab5e2fe768c9c655c248151c2d9a155c232a5a8
confirmations
82592
spent
true